Es Experiment 6
Es Experiment 6
Es Experiment 6
EXPERIMENT 6
PROGRAM:
#include<lpc214x.h>
unsigned int i;
void lcd_int();
void main()
IO0DIR =0XFFF;
IO1DIR = 0x0;
lcd_int();
cmd(0x80);
while(1) {
if(IR == 0) {
string("Obstacle Detcted");
delay;delay;
cmd(0x01);
void lcd_int()
cmd(0x38);
cmd(0x0c);
cmd(0x06);
1|Page
TY EXTC A 34 KASTURI MAHENDRA KAMBLE
cmd(0x01);
cmd(0x80);
IO0PIN&=0x00;
IO0PIN|=(a<<0);
IO0CLR|=bit(8); //rs=0
IO0CLR|=bit(9); //rw=0
IO0SET|=bit(10); //en=1
delay;
IO0CLR|=bit(10); //en=0
IO0PIN&=0x00;
IO0PIN|=(b<<0);
IO0SET|=bit(8); //rs=1
IO0CLR|=bit(9); //rw=0
IO0SET|=bit(10); //en=1
delay;
IO0CLR|=bit(10); //en=0
while(*p!='\0') {
dat(*p++);
}}
2|Page
TY EXTC A 34 KASTURI MAHENDRA KAMBLE
OUTPUT:
3|Page